The Job of a Medical Assistant

medical assistant with Florissant CO nursing home patientThe duties of a medical assistant can be varied as well as challenging. Essentially their job is ensure that the Florissant CO hospitals, clinics and other medical care facilities where they work run successfully. Based on the size or type of facility, they can be more of an administrative assistant, a clinical assistant, or in smaller facilities both. They are responsible for giving direct assistance to the physicians, nurses and other medical professionals but can also be found performing duties at the front desk or in an office. Some of the possible duties of a medical assistant include:

  • Filling out insurance forms and submitting claims
  • Setting and confirming appointments
  • Taking vital signs and weighing patients
  • Taking blood and other tissue and fluid specimens
  • Preparing rooms and instruments for doctors
  • Giving basic support during examinations and procedures

Even though medical assistants may perform almost any duty they are qualified to under Colorado law, some choose to specialize in a specific area and attain certification. Two of the choices offered are for the Certified Clinical Medical Assistant (CCMA) and the Certified Medical Administrative Assistant (CMAA) offered by the National Healthcareer Association (NHA).

Medical Assistant Education

Unlike most other medical professionals, medical assistants are not mandated to become certified, licensed, or to obtain a college degree. However, many Florissant CO health care employers choose to hire graduates of an accredited medical assistant training program (more on accreditation later ) that are certified. There are basically 2 choices available for a formal education. The first and quickest route to becoming a medical assistant is to obtain a certificate or diploma. These programs typically take about one year to complete, a few as little as six to nine months. They are developed to teach the basics of medical assisting and ready graduates for entry level positions. The second alternative is to obtain an Associate Degree, which are typically two year programs offered at community and junior colleges in addition to technical and vocational schools. They are more expansive in nature than the certificate or diploma programs, and include liberal arts courses in addition to the medical assistant classes. They often have a practical component requiring an internship with a local medical practice. Associate Degrees are often a pre-requisite for and credits can be transferred to a 4 year Bachelor’s Degree in Medical Assistant Studies or a related field.

Certification Options for Medical Assistants

As previously mentioned, certification is not a legal requirement, but is an excellent idea for those who want to boost their careers. It will not only help in obtaining employment after graduation, but it may also help with initial salary negotiations. Some potential Florissant CO medical employers simply will not hire a medical assistant that has not obtained accredited formal training or certification. One of the most popular and arguably the most highly regarded certification is the Certified Medical Assistant (CMA) provided by the American Association of Medical Assistants (AAMA). In order to apply for the CMA examination, a candidate must be a graduate or will be graduating within thirty days from an accredited medical assistant program. Other certifications are available as well, for instance the CMAA and the CCMA that we previously mentioned which are offered by the NHA.

Is the Medical Assistant School Accredited? There are many good reasons to ensure that the college you enroll in is accredited. First, accreditation helps guarantee that the instruction you receive will be both comprehensive and of the highest quality. Second, if you plan on becoming certified, you must enroll in an accredited program. Two of the approved agencies for accreditation are the Accrediting Bureau of Health Education Schools (ABHES) and the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P). If your school is not accredited by either of these agencies, you will not be allowed to take the CMA exam. Additionally, if you anticipate applying for a student loan or financial aid, they are frequently not available for non-accredited programs. And last, as mentioned previously, many potential Florissant CO employers will not employ a medical assistant who has not graduated from an accredited program.

Florissant, Colorado

Florissant is a census-designated place and a U.S. Post Office in Teller County, Colorado, United States. The population as of the 2010 Census was 104.[3] Florissant, Colorado, was named after Florissant, Missouri, the hometown of Judge James Castello, an early settler.[4] The word florissant is the gerund of the French verb fleurir, which roughly means to flourish, to flower, or to blossom.[5]
